Output 31b9223ab5cfa8bc39dc403f46b3b68abbbdfce2ded901656827bc4e4e58965a:1

value
4863594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900c0f9330da6b46dbfc9c2c97d0c6a42e242585 OP_EQUAL
address
3EpfgAmLNKnjpq8hg9V2wLRfXJX12Nqe6G
transaction
31b9223ab5cfa8bc39dc403f46b3b68abbbdfce2ded901656827bc4e4e58965a
spent
true